* org.el (org-store-link): Storing of links to headlines in indirect buffers was broken. Fix it. TINYCHANGE Summary: > When org-store-link is invoked on a headline in indirect buffer (as in a > capture buffer), hyperlink gets created to the file and NOT the > headline. This is a bug. > > The attached patch fixes this. > > Setup: > > # ~/.emacs > > (defun my-conversation-id () > (interactive) > > (remove-hook 'org-capture-before-finalize-hook 'my-conversation-id) > > (let ((org-link-to-org-use-id t)) > (call-interactively 'org-store-link) > ) > ) > > # org-capture-templates > > ("x" "Conversations" entry > (file+headline "~/conversation.org" "Conversations") > "%(progn (add-hook 'org-capture-before-finalize-hook 'my-conversation-id) \"\")** Note taken on %U\n %? " :prepend t :empty-lines 1) > > Steps for reproduction: > > Trigger org-capture for the above capture entry. > > Examine conversation.org before/after the patch is applied. Note the > absence/presence of IDs for the captured entry. > > Check for the stored links using C-c C-l. Note the file/headline links. > > # file conversation.org before and after the patch > > * Conversations > > ** Note taken on [2010-08-23 Mon 04:33] > :PROPERTIES: > :ID: 7e1974a6-8fa1-43cf-bef3-2adf37d99130 > :END: > > ** Note taken on [2010-08-23 Mon 04:32] > > # (org-insert-link) showing stored links before and after the patch > > file:~/conversation.org (file:~/conversation.org) > id:7e1974a6-8fa1-43cf-bef3-2adf37d99130 (Note taken on [2010-08-23 Mon 04:33]) > |

README
This is the Emacs Org project, an emacs subsystem for organizing your life The homepage of Org is at http://orgmode.org This distribution contains: README This file. README_DIST The README file for the distribution (zip and tar files) README_GIT Information about the git repository and how to contribute to Org-mode development. lisp/ Directory with all the Emacs Lisp files that make up Org. doc/ The documentation files. org.texi is the source of the documentation, org.html and org.pdf are formatted versions of it. contrib/ A directory with third-party additions for Org. Some really cool stuff is in there. ORGWEBPAGE/ Directory with the source files for the orgmode.org web page. ChangeLog The standard ChangeLog file. Makefile The makefile to compile and install Org, and also for maintenance tasks. request-assign-future.txt The form that contributors have to sign and get processed with the FSF before contributed changes can be integrated into the Org core. All files in this distribution except the CONTRIB directory have copyright assigned to the FSF. EXPERIMENTAL Experimental code, not necessarily FSF copyright.
